WebJan 12, 2024 · Unplug the freezer from the mains Locate the start relay. Unplug and remove the relay from the compressor (usually by unscrewing it) Use a multimeter to test for continuity between the start and run terminals. If it fails a continuity test or smells burnt, swap it out for a new one.
